As part of the talk series exploring anti racist practices in the Scandinavian fashion industry, Amelia Hoy discusses creating inclusive platforms and new narratives with Ervin Latimer, Fashion designer & writer.

Biographies

Ervin Latimer is a Finnish American designer, writer and queer artist with an international career in fashion design. In September 2020, he was awarded as the Young Fashion Designer of the Year in Finland. Alongside creative projects, Latimer works as the Managing Editor of Ruskeat Tytöt (Brown Girls), an online platform devoted to the normalization of marginalized people in the fields of media and culture in Finland.

American Danish Actor Amelia Hoy graduated from the acclaimed conservation The Danish National School of Performing Arts in 2015, and now works internationally. She is currently starring in the Antarctic drama series ‘The Head’. Amelia has hosted content for Copenhagen Fashion Week and Copenhagen Fashion Summit for several years, also interviewing talent, press, and international fashion professionals.
